Moreland University is looking for a Director of Partnerships to own the full lifecycle of our district and institutional partnerships — from first conversation to signed, multi-year expansion. This is an individual contributor role for someone who wants to build and run their own territory, not manage a team. You'll personally source, close, and grow partnerships with K-12 districts, state education agencies, and higher-ed systems, bringing Moreland's educator certification, mentorship, and professional development solutions to scale.
You'll set the territory strategy, keep your pipeline forecast-ready, and work cross-functionally with Account Management, Legal, Marketing, and Operations to make sure every partnership we sign gets delivered on well.
What You'll Do
Own new acquisition and expansion efforts across your assigned territory, including building target account lists, executing outreach strategies, and managing your pipeline end-to-end.
Manage the full sales cycle, including discovery, solution design, pricing and proposal development, negotiation, and contract execution, while partnering with Legal and Finance as needed.
Lead strategic account planning and drive upsell and cross-sell opportunities through a consistent cadence of Quarterly Business Reviews (QBRs) and Monthly Business Reviews (MBRs).
Maintain accurate CRM data and sales forecasts, partnering closely with RevOps to ensure strong reporting and pipeline visibility.
Represent Moreland at conferences, superintendent and administrator forums, and other customer-facing industry events.
Strengthen Moreland's brand presence within your territory through case studies, webinars, co-marketing initiatives, and community-building with partner districts.
Identify and navigate funding opportunities, including grants, philanthropic programs, and state or federal funding sources, to help partner districts offset tuition and licensure costs
What You'll Bring
7–15 years in K-12 partnerships, business development, or strategic accounts (edtech, certification, or professional development background preferred)
A track record of closing complex, six-figure-plus ACV deals with multiple stakeholders and long sales cycles
Experience building partnerships within top-500 U.S. school districts, state DOEs, or higher-ed systems
Strong track record in both new logo acquisition and expanding existing accounts
CRM discipline (HubSpot or Salesforce) and comfort owning your own forecast
Executive-level communication and negotiation skills — you're comfortable in the room with a superintendent or a state Chief Academic Officer
Willingness to travel up to 25%
Bonus: formal sales methodology training (Challenger, MEDDIC, Solution Selling, Sandler, or similar)
What Success Looks Like
New bookings (ACV/TCV), win rate, and stage velocity against territory targets
Growth in ICP segment penetration, including Enterprise-tier districts
Expansion revenue and multi-year renewal attainment
Healthy pipeline coverage (3.5–4x) and forecast accuracy
Strong partner NPS and QBR/MBR cadence adherence
